One Stop Shop Community Reentry Program Act of 2026
Reentry Services: One-Stop Community Centers
This bill is currently in the early stages of the legislative process after being introduced in the House. It has been sent to the House Committee on the Judiciary for review. No further actions are scheduled at this time.

Key Points
- The bill creates a grant program for nonprofit organizations to run one-stop centers that help people returning from prison or jail. These centers would provide many services in a single location, such as help finding a job, securing housing, and getting a driver's license or ID card.
- People using the centers would receive a personal plan based on their specific needs. Services include mental health care, drug treatment, legal help for cleaning up criminal records, and even basic needs like a cell phone or bus fare to get to appointments.
- The plan also sets up 24-hour hotlines that people can call or text for help finding local resources. These hotlines must be private and accessible to people who speak different languages or have disabilities.
- Organizations that hire formerly incarcerated people to run these programs would get special preference for the funding. The goal is to use the experience of people who have been through the system to help others succeed and stay out of prison.
- The bill authorizes $11.5 million in yearly funding from 2027 through 2031. The Attorney General would be required to report back to Congress every year on how many people are getting jobs, finding homes, and staying out of trouble because of these centers.
